在一定时间后退出

Jam*_*man 0 javascript php

在X秒不活动后,从PHP应用程序注销用户(所以基本上只是执行重定向)的最佳方法是什么?对于"不活动",我会计算最后一页加载的时间,如果当前时间超过X秒,请执行重定向.

这是需要用Javascript实现的吗?

Eld*_*rov 6

你可以只使用html元标记:
<meta http-equiv="refresh" content="1000;url=buy.aspx">
把它放在头部
,其中1000是秒的时间,网址是重定向的网址.


CMS*_*CMS 5

刚刚回答了这个问题 ...... OP希望在一定时间后询问用户是否希望保持登录状态.

对于没有任何确认的普通重定向,您可以使用简单的setTimeout调用:

var minutes = 30;
setTimeout(function(){location.href = 'logout.php';}, minutes*60*1000); 
Run Code Online (Sandbox Code Playgroud)